Sewer Scope Inspection: What to Expect & Why It's Important
A sewer scope inspection is a essential part of home maintenance and purchasing a residence. During this service, a specialized technician uses a small camera attached to a pliable cable to carefully check the interior of your underground drain lines. You can foresee the plumber to carefully guide the scope through the conduit , identifying any breaks , vegetation intrusion, obstructions, or other issues . This inspection helps prevent costly fixes and confirms the adequate performance of your sewer system.
Uncovering Hidden Problems with Sewer Video Inspections
Sewer video evaluations are a crucial technique for locating underlying problems within your drainage lines. While seemingly straightforward, these checks can expose significant issues than initially expected. Typical findings include breaks in the pipes, plant intrusion, misalignment, and even collapsed sections. Ignoring these initial warnings can lead to expensive replacements and potentially major service interruptions. A thorough inspection provides valuable insight for scheduled maintenance and can protect you from coming difficulties.

An Benefits for a Sewer Camera Inspection for Homeowners
Regularly evaluating your home's sewer pipe is vital in detecting costly issues down the road. A sewer camera assessment provides property owners with a complete view of the buried lines, permitting the detection for potential cracks, clogs, root growth, and other damage. Such early solution will save you resources plus prevent the stress related to sudden restorations.
